Plot Summary

This ground breaking action-packed documentary takes you back to the winter of 1975 in Hawaii —a dramatic moment in history when a group of young South African and Australian surfers sacrificed everything. They put it all on the line to create a sport, a culture, and an industry that is today worth billions of dollars and has captured the imagination of the world. A powerhouse film, the spell-binding action footage and fascinating subjects make 'Bustin' Down the Door' a surfing classic.

Top Critics' Reviews

Fresh: Happily, the filmmaker, Jeremy Gosch, puts his wide-eyed narrative together with an easy touch. With its amazing wall-to-wall footage of oceanic derring-do Bustin' Down the Door plays like visual air-conditioning. – Nathan Lee, New York Times, Jun 24, 2010

Fresh: With verve, style and a fine sense of the human side of surf culture, Jeremy Gosch makes a terrific splash with his debut doc. – Robert Koehler, Variety, Jul 7, 2010

Fresh: Bustin' Down the Door entertainingly captures surfing's last great hoorah of no-holds-barred radicalism. – Robert Abele, Los Angeles Times, Jun 24, 2010

Rotten: The film tries to tell us that money hasn't spoiled the fun, but I was much more curious about the black shorts than the Quicksilver brand board shorts. – Reyhan Harmanci, San Francisco Chronicle, Aug 6, 2008
